Caruaru weather in June

In June, Caruaru sees average daytime highs of 26°C and overnight lows near 19°C, with 52 mm of rain across 12.3 wet days and about 11.5 hours of daylight. It is the 10th-warmest and 4th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 26°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 10% of the time in June, and the air most often feels muggy.

Daylight stretches from about 11 h 36 min at the start of June to 11 h 30 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, June is Caruaru's 11th-clearest and 6th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Caruaru's year-round climate.

Temperature in June

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 26°C through the month.

A typical June day in Caruaru reaches about 26°C in the afternoon and slips back to 19°C overnight — a 7°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 24°C and 27°C. Set against its neighbours, June runs about 2°C cooler than May and on par with July.

Location & terrain

Where is Caruaru?

Caruaru sits at 8.3°S, 36.0°W, 568 m above sea level, in Brazil. The nearest listed city is São Caitano, 19 km away.

Topography around Caruaru

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Caruaru.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Caruaru has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 133 m around an average of 554 m above sea level; within 16 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 597 m; within 80 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,134 m.

The land around Caruaru is covered by artificial surfaces (72%) within 3 km, grassland (59%) within 16 km, and grassland (58%) and shrubs (21%) within 80 km.
